How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cedarbrook?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cedarbrook Studio Apartments | $1,364 | $1,169 | $1,485 |
Cedarbrook 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,501 | $950 | $2,140 |
Cedarbrook 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,154 | $1,275 | $2,785 |
Cedarbrook 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,728 | $2,395 | $3,830 |
Cedarbrook 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,760 | $3,760 | $3,760 |
